Characterful old hotel, positioned centrally in the lovely little town of Woodbridge. It is old so floors are uneven and stairs are quite steep, but they are quite clear about this in the booking, so if you do have any mobility issues ask for a room on the lowest floor possible. The room was decent, the shower room a bit dated (but not unexpected) but totally serviceable. I didn't have dinner here but the standard and presentation of breakfast was very good. Must compliment all the staff on reception, evening bar and morning breakfast; all first class, happy, welcoming and helpful. When it is as consistent as this, it does indicate a well run establishment.

Car parking is very limited (you can book apparently). If you are just staying for the night you should be able to get parked on the road nearby, as I did, as long as you are away by about 8.30am in the morning.

My husband has mobility issues, so we booked a parking space and were assigned the one right by the door for easy access. The lovely receptionist (sadly, I don't have her name ) was brilliant, with a bright, cheery welcome. She insisted on carrying our bag from the car to our room, again given to us for ease, not too many steps. The room was charming with older period furniture and the colours of the curtains and décor were calming. The room also had hand-made shortbread with plenty of tea and coffee supplies. A small ironing board and iron there which I used and rarely have found available. We booked in for dinner the service was superb as was the food you couldn't fault anything. A good night's sleep it was so quiet and a wonderful breakfast with a great choice on the menu. Again great service, the receptionist from the day before asked us if we had a good meal and slept well. Oh, and she also recommended a great blush prosecco for me which I had with my meal. Outside the Bull Inn, there is a good amount of seating with flower troughs with an abundance of fresh herbs growing in them which was great the soft smell of sage and thyme. It was such a lovely stay we would certainly go there again. The location was really good with ease of access to Woodbridge with some really good niche shops and restaurants. At what times are check-in and check-out at The Bull Inn?

The Bull Inn accommodates check-ins starting from 03:00 PM and ending at 11:00 PM. The rooms should be vacated by 11:00 AM.

Is vehicle parking offered by The Bull Inn?

Yes, there is parking available at The Bull Inn. The parking is private and on site. However, it is important to note that parking reservation is required and there is a cost of £5 per day.
